Haryana govt extends lockdown till 19th July; 100 people allowed in wedding & funeral

The Haryana government has extended Covid-19 lockdown in the state till July 19 with certain relaxations. According to the order issued by Haryana State Disaster Management Authority, a maximum of 100 people are allowed in gatherings for weddings and funerals.

In open spaces, gatherings will be allowed upto 200 persons subject to strict observance of COVID-19 appropriate behavioural norms and social distancing.

Spas are allowed to open from 6 am to 8 pm with 50 per cent capacity.

Swimming pools are allowed to open only for such athletes/swimmers who are competing or practicing for a competitive event after adopting requisite social distancing norms, regular sanitisation and Covid appropriate behavioural norms.

Cinema halls are allowed to open with maximum 50 per cent seating capacity with adherence of requisite social distancing norms.
